Education ministers’ meeting over closure of schools postponed

ISLAMABAD: A meeting of education ministers chaired by the Federal Minister for Education Shafqat Mahmood has been adjourned today to enforce lockdown in view of increasing cases of the corona.

According to details, important decisions were expected at a meeting of inter-provincial education ministers chaired by Shafqat Mahmood on the implementation of smart lockdown due to the spread of a new type of coronavirus’ Omicron variant across the country.

Education and training are being conducted across the country with the implementation of SOPs for the prevention of coronavirus, however, in view of the rising number of virus cases, today’s meeting of the Education Ministers to review the situation of educational institutions was postponed.

The inter-provincial education ministers meeting, Shafqat Mahmood, was also to discuss the timely availability and delivery of textbooks across the country. According to the Ministry of Education, the meeting of education ministers was adjourned till next week.

It may be recalled that earlier, in view of the spread of Omicron in Qatar, it was decided to adopt a distance education system by closing all educational institutions for one week from January 2. The closure of educational institutions in other countries including Pakistan is also under consideration.

Attendance at all public and private schools in Qatar has been suspended since Sunday. The move came after an increase in Omi Crown cases in the country, the education ministry said that the closure was decided to prevent a new type of coronavirus.
